(Calexico Unified School District)....They have released a statement.

It is on the arrest this week of one of their substitute teacher. The District confirmed they had reported the incident to the Calexico Police after learning of the accusations against the substitute. They also confirmed the employee was immediately placed on administrative leave and removed from the campus. In the statement, the District said due to student and employee confidentiality laws, they were not able to release anymore details. They did want the community to know that all CUSD employees must clear a fingerprint criminal background check through the Department of Justice. Additionally, they said all staff is mandated to complete sexual harrassment prevention andf Title iX training on a yearly basis. The Calexico Police are continuing to investigate the allegations against the 26 year old suspect.
